The GT25C256-2UDLI-TR is a 256K-bit CMOS serial EEPROM (Electrically Erasable Programmable Read-Only Memory) manufactured by Giantec. This memory device features a serial interface, making it suitable for applications where a small footprint and low pin count are essential. It's commonly used for storing configuration data, calibration settings, and other non-volatile information in a variety of electronic systems.

Features
- 256K-bit (32K x 8) capacity
- Standard SPI (Serial Peripheral Interface)
- High-speed clock frequency (up to 20 MHz)
- Low voltage operation (2.5V to 5.5V)
- Low power consumption
- Write protect feature
- Software write protection
- Page write mode (up to 64 bytes)
- Endurance: 1,000,000 write cycles
- Data retention: 100 years
- Available in various packages including SOIC, TSSOP, and DIP
- RoHS compliant

Technical Specifications
The GT25C256-2UDLI-TR operates at a voltage range of 2.5V to 5.5V, making it compatible with a wide range of microcontrollers and systems. Its SPI interface supports clock frequencies up to 20 MHz, enabling fast data transfer. The device features a page write mode that allows writing up to 64 bytes of data in a single operation, improving write efficiency. It typically comes in a SOIC-8 package. The operating temperature range is typically from -40°C to +85°C. The 'TR' suffix often indicates tape and reel packaging for automated assembly.
The memory is organized as 32,768 x 8 bits. It has a typical write cycle time of 5 ms and a typical read cycle time dependent on the SPI clock frequency. It supports both hardware and software write protection mechanisms. The device guarantees data retention for 100 years and can withstand at least 1,000,000 write cycles.
